## Webhook Retry Semantics — Signing Notes

Fergale retries failed webhook deliveries with exponential backoff, capped at six attempts over two hours. Each retry re-signs the payload with a fresh timestamp to prevent replay acceptance outside the tolerance window. Receivers must validate the signature on every attempt, not just the first. All deliveries from the Orvik cluster are signed with the key below.

deploy key for kahof-tadup: bky4_rRMZ

Subject: Quickstore 4.2 — bloom filter now fronts the KV layer

Plugin authors: starting with this release, Quickstore places a bloom filter ahead of the key-value store. Negative lookups return faster; false positives fall through safely. No API changes are required on your side. Verify your plugin against the staging build referenced below.

session token of fahif-tadup = htk3_9c7

Finance Review Summary — Training Budget, Next Year

Training budget approved at 2.1 percent of payroll, down slightly from this year. Priority goes to the Silverpine certification track and onboarding for the new Marwick till system. Branch allocations are fixed; no mid-year transfers. External courses require regional approval. Unused funds lapse at year-end. Submit branch training plans by the end of next month. The confidential business plan note follows below.

internal memo for fajog-yagaf: Gross margin on Ulaael came in at 20 percent against a plan of 10 percent. Only 9 of the 80 pilot accounts renewed Ulaael, so a churn review is set for July 1.